So I want to run a zombie apocalypse game, using the world of darkness rules. My problem is, I want the players to eventually form a society and care about then npcs. How do I stop them from banding together and treating the npcs like redshirts instead of people?

Something I attempted was separating NPCS into two groups "Survivors" had their own character sheets and had a unique flair.

"Citizens" were run of the mill people who may have been laborers or other simple jobs and they would reduce build/healing/etc rates at the fortress.

Losing citizenry hurt players by losing game mechanics but losing a survivor that the group liked was always a good moment.

Are there intresting monsters that are basically human (or demi-human) but infected with something magical or similar, other than lycanthropes or vampires? I'm trying to write an adventure for my group, and it's going to have a murderer who's secretly something monstrous, but I don't really want it to be something so overused. It'd be cooler to have something a bit less common. I just can't seem to think of any off the top off my head.

What other monsters would fit well into a supernatural killer adventure where the killer is pretending to be an ordinary person and has to be exposed? Bonus points for something unconventional that would really surprise the playes and their characters. No points for suggesting doppelgangers.

Other than non-Voodoo zombies, there's a few I can think of off the top of my head.

>Cult of former humans who, due to exceptional circumstances or their own free will, consumed human flesh. Over time, the consumption to feed exclusively on human flesh began to corrupt them, and their desire for flesh overrode any and all other personality traits they may have had, and the residual magic of their actions and their surroundings turned them into silent, barely-humanoid creatures of the night, who despite their ferocity and inhumanity still retain a large amount of their cunning and intellect.

Alternatively,

>man who has been possessed by a particularly insidious demon. The demon grants him charisma, power, strength, and intellect, as well as great health, but at a price - he must kill a specific type of person whenever the demon demands it be done. While this is usually at a specific intervals and in a specific manner, the demon can make those demands at any time, and they must be complied with in a reasonable time frame, or else the demon will full-on possess his body, turning it into a horrific monster and casting the mans soul irreversibly into whatever particular hell your setting has with no hope of resurrection. While the demon takes the long-game approach, and feels it can sate itself better by siphoning off a little at a time over a long period rather than a brief but hyper-violent existence, it has no problems killing the man - after all, he can always possess a new body.
>this man will most likely be a well-liked and upstanding member of the community, with a great many people who love and depend on him.
